Effective Solutions to Combat ‘Halo Infinite’ PC Crashes
Ensure Game File Integrity
Game file corruption could be at the root of your problems. Perform a file check to restore any missing or corrupt files:
- Launch Steam and navigate to your library.
- Right-click ‘Halo Infinite’ and select ‘Properties.’
- Click on ‘Local Files’ then ‘Verify integrity of game files.’
- Once the check is complete, reboot ‘Halo Infinite’ to test stability.
Turn Off Steam Overlay
Interference from Steam Overlay can lead to crashes. Disabling it might stabilize the game:
- In Steam’s library, right-click ‘Halo Infinite’ and select ‘Properties.’
- Deselect ‘Enable Steam Overlay while in-game.’

Opt-Out of Full-Screen Optimizations
At times, full-screen optimizations might conflict with game settings, thus disabling them is beneficial:
- Go to ‘Properties’ through the Steam library and select ‘Local Files’ > ‘Browse.’
- Right-click the ‘Halo Infinite’ executable, choose ‘Properties,’ and navigate to the ‘Compatibility’ tab.
- Check ‘Disable full-screen optimizations.’
- Click ‘Change High DPI settings’ and enable ‘Override High DPI Scaling Behavior.’
- Launch the game to observe any improvements.
Stay Up-to-date with System Software
Keeping your operating system updated prevents software conflicts:
- Access ‘Update & Security’ through Windows Settings and ‘Check for updates.’
- Install any pending updates and reboot your PC.
- Assess ‘Halo Infinite’ performance post-update.
Verify DLC Settings
Managing your DLC, like the ‘High Resolution Multiplayer Textures’ pack, may alleviate stress on your system:
- Within Steam, select ‘Halo Infinite’ and navigate to ‘Properties’ > ‘DLC.’
- Untick ‘High Resolution Multiplayer Textures’ and recheck game stability.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What should I do if ‘Halo Infinite’ crashes at startup?
A: Attempt launching ‘Halo Infinite’ with administrator privileges and check the integrity of game files through Steam’s ‘Verify Integrity of Game Files’ feature.
Q: Why is my PC unable to run ‘Halo Infinite’ without crashes?
A: Crashes can stem from various issues such as outdated system drivers, game file corruption, software conflicts, or hardware limitations.
